Kotak Mahindra MF, Fidelity, Morgan Stanley, and Citigroup Global Markets Mauritius are among those entities that collectively bought a 10.64% stake in Home First Finance Company India for ₹1,307 crore through open market transactions on Monday, August 11.

According to the block deal data available on the National Stock Exchange (NSE), Kotak Mahindra Mutual Fund (MF) bought 50 lakh shares or a 4.84% stake in Home First Finance Company.

In addition, HSBC MF, Motilal Oswal MF, Kotak Mahindra Life Insurance, HDFC Life Insurance, Norway's Government Pension Fund Global, and the Master Trust of Bank of Japan picked up more than 1.09 crore shares of Mumbai-headquartered Home First Finance, as per the data.

The shares were acquired at an average price of ₹1,190.50 apiece, taking the transaction value to ₹1,307.17 crore.

Meanwhile, private equity major Warburg Pincus exited the firm by offloading its entire 10.64% stake in Home First Finance Company India.

Warburg Pincus divested its holding in Home First Finance through its affiliate Orange Clove Investments BV.

In December 2024, Warburg Pincus, along with two promoter entities of Home First Finance, divested a 19.6% stake in the affordable housing finance company for a combined amount of ₹1,728 crore.

In November 2023, promoters of Home First Finance -- True North Fund V, Aether Mauritius, and Warburg Pincus -- collectively pared a 9.8% stake in Home First Finance for ₹753 crore.

The stock of Home First Finance Company closed 6.44% higher at ₹1,279.70 per equity share on the NSE on Monday. During the trading session, the scrip surged 7.54% to an intra-day high of ₹1,292.90 apiece.

The firm has a total market capitalisation of ₹13,215.28 crore, as of August 11, 2025, as per data on the NSE.
